«Ex Inspection and Maintenance» subject includes theoretical and practical information about advanced training for work on any type of vessel. The test is designed to provide advanced training for personnel working on ships of various types. It involves the regular examination and upkeep of equipment and facilities to ensure they meet safety and operational standards. The primary goal of the test is to prevent equipment failures and ensure the safety of personnel and the environment. These inspections are crucial for identifying potential hazards and addressing them before they become significant issues. Regular maintenance activities include cleaning, lubricating and replacing worn-out parts to extend the lifespan of the equipment. The course procedures are often guided by regulatory requirements and industry best practices. Proper documentation of inspections and maintenance activities is essential for tracking the condition of equipment over time. Training programs are often implemented to ensure that personnel are knowledgeable about the inspection and maintenance processes. Effective test can lead to increased efficiency, reduced downtime and lower operational costs.
